That's a lot of ifs, and none of them could be fulfilled in the foreseeable
future.

Situation you describe is impossible.
When there is a split-brain and someone drops and re-creating logical slots
with the same names on the old primary - such node can't be joined as a
standby without pg_rewind.
In its current state pg_rewind wipes the pg_replslot directory, and
therefore there will be no replication slots.
That is, if there is a logical replication slot with failover=true and
synced=false on a healthy standby, it could have happened only because the
old primary was shut down gracefully.
